Referring to the attached drawings 1-3, a mechanical equipment supporting and overhauling device comprises a base 1, a transversely arranged overhauling table 2 is arranged above the base 1, a rotating groove 3 is formed in the bottom of the overhauling table 2, a transversely arranged connecting block 4 is connected inside the rotating groove 3 in a rotating mode, the connecting block 4 is rotatably connected inside the rotating groove 3, vertically arranged hydraulic cylinders 5 are welded at four corners of the top of the base 1, piston ends of the hydraulic cylinders 5 are welded at four corners of the bottom of the connecting block 4, a steering mechanism is arranged at the top of the base 1, four symmetrically arranged connecting holes 15 are formed in the base 1, a moving mechanism is arranged inside the connecting holes 15, when a user needs to overhaul mechanical equipment, the mechanical equipment can be placed at the top of the overhauling table 2, the user can adjust the height of the mechanical equipment according to overhauling requirements, and when the user needs to adjust the height of the mechanical equipment, the operation of accessible pneumatic cylinder 5 this moment drives connecting block 4 and carries out vertical displacement, drives maintenance platform 2 and carries out vertical displacement, drives mechanical equipment and carries out vertical displacement, and the use that the user can be convenient at this moment overhauls the instrument and overhauls mechanical equipment and maintain.
The steering mechanism comprises a connecting column 6 and a driving motor 11, the bottom of the connecting column 6 is rotatably connected to the top of the base 1 through a bearing, the connecting column 6 is provided with a connecting groove 7, the inside of the connecting groove 7 is slidably connected with a positioning block 8 which is transversely arranged, the positioning block 8 is of a rectangular structure, a linkage column 9 which is vertically arranged is welded to the top of the positioning block 8, the top of the linkage column 9 extends out of the linkage column 9 and is welded to the inner wall of the top of the rotating groove 3, the outer wall of the connecting column 6 is fixedly sleeved with a driven wheel 10, the driving motor 11 is welded to the top of the base 1, the output end of the driving motor 11 is fixedly sleeved with a driving wheel 12 which is transversely arranged, the driving wheel 12 is meshed with the driven wheel 10 to work, and when a user needs to overhaul and maintain components at other, the drive rotates from driving wheel 10, drive spliced pole 6 and rotate, drive locating piece 8 and rotate, drive spliced pole 6 and rotate, drive access platform 2 and rotate, thereby drive the mechanical equipment on access platform 2 and rotate, the user can adjust mechanical equipment's angle this moment, the user can be convenient overhauls the part to other angles of mechanical equipment and maintains this moment, mechanical equipment's maintenance efficiency is improved.
The moving mechanism comprises a pushing column 14 and a universal wheel 17, the pushing column 14 is welded on four corners of the bottom of the connecting block 4, the universal wheel 17 is movably connected inside the connecting hole 15, a transversely arranged limiting block 16 is welded on the top of the universal wheel 17, limiting grooves 18 are formed in inner walls of two sides of the connecting hole 15, two ends of the limiting block 16 are slidably connected inside the limiting grooves 18, the bottom of the pushing column 14 corresponds to the limiting block 16, the thickness of the base 1 is larger than the height of the universal wheel 17, when a user needs to carry the supporting and overhauling device, the connecting block 4 can be driven to vertically displace downwards through the operation of the hydraulic cylinder 5, the pushing column 14 is driven to vertically displace downwards, the pushing column 14 is driven to abut against the limiting block 16, the limiting block 16 is driven to vertically displace downwards, the universal wheel 17 is driven to slide out of the inside of the connecting hole 15, and, at the moment, the user can push the supporting and overhauling device, and at the moment, the supporting and overhauling device can be driven to move through the rotation of the universal wheel 17, and when the user does not need to move the supporting and overhauling device, the hydraulic cylinder 5 can be operated to drive the connecting block 4 to vertically move upwards, the pushing column 14 is driven to vertically move upwards, the universal wheel 17 can be pushed to slide into the connecting hole 15 by the gravity of the supporting and overhauling device, the base 1 is contacted with the ground, the supporting and overhauling device is stabilized on the ground, the user can use the supporting and overhauling device to support mechanical equipment, meanwhile, the universal wheel 17 can be efficiently protected by the aid of the universal wheel 17, the universal wheel 17 is prevented from being pressed by a supporting and overhauling device for a long time, the universal wheel 17 is damaged, and the service life of the universal wheel 17 is prolonged.
One end threaded connection of connecting block 4 has the bolt 19 of vertical setting, a plurality of thread grooves 20 have been seted up along circumference to the inner wall of rotating groove 3 bottom, bolt 19 and the thread groove 20 screw-thread fit work, cooperation through bolt 19 and corresponding thread groove 20, the user can be quick fixes maintenance platform 2 and connecting block 4, avoid the user at the in-process of overhauing and maintaining mechanical equipment, maintenance platform 2 takes place the skew, the person of facilitating the use overhauls mechanical equipment and maintains, carry the working property that supports the maintenance device.
Linkage post 9 sliding connection is in the inside of spread groove 7, and linkage post 9's length is greater than the length of spliced pole 6, and movable hole 13 has been seted up at the middle part of connecting block 4, and linkage post 9 rotates the inside of connecting at movable hole 13, through movable hole 13, and linkage post 9 can carry out free rotation to the person of facilitating the use adjusts the angle of access desk 2.
The working principle is as follows: when a user needs to overhaul mechanical equipment, the mechanical equipment can be placed at the top of the overhaul platform 2, the user can adjust the height of the mechanical equipment according to the overhaul requirement, and when the user needs to adjust the height of the mechanical equipment, the hydraulic cylinder 5 can be operated to drive the connecting block 4 to vertically displace to drive the overhaul platform 2 to vertically displace to drive the mechanical equipment to vertically displace, the user can conveniently use an overhaul instrument to overhaul and maintain the mechanical equipment, and when the user needs to overhaul and maintain components at other angles of the mechanical equipment, the driving wheel 12 can be driven to rotate by the operation of the driving motor 11 to drive the driven wheel 10 to rotate to drive the connecting column 6 to rotate to drive the positioning block 8 to rotate to drive the connecting column 6 to rotate, the maintenance platform 2 is driven to rotate, so as to drive the mechanical equipment on the maintenance platform 2 to rotate, when the angle of the maintenance platform 2 is adjusted by a user, the bolt 19 can be rotated at the moment, the bolt 19 is driven to enter the corresponding thread groove 20, the maintenance platform 2 is fixed with the connecting block 4 at the moment, the user can conveniently maintain parts at other angles of the mechanical equipment at the moment, the maintenance efficiency of the mechanical equipment is improved, and when the user needs to carry the supporting maintenance device, the connecting block 4 is driven to vertically displace downwards by the operation of the hydraulic cylinder 5 at the moment, the pushing column 14 is driven to vertically displace downwards, the pushing column 14 is driven to abut against the limiting block 16, the limiting block 16 is driven to vertically displace downwards, the universal wheel 17 is driven to slide out of the connecting hole 15, the universal wheel 17 is driven to contact with the ground, and the supporting maintenance device can be pushed by the user, accessible universal wheel 17's rotation this moment, it moves to drive the support and overhauls the device, and when the user need not remove the support and overhaul the device, accessible pneumatic cylinder 5's operation this moment, drive connecting block 4 and carry out vertical ascending displacement, it carries out vertical ascending displacement to drive promotion post 14, gravity through supporting maintenance device self this moment, will promote the inside that universal wheel 17 slided into connecting hole 15, base 1 contacts with ground this moment, it is subaerial to be firm when supporting maintenance device this moment, the user can use the support to overhaul the device and support mechanical equipment this moment.
